]> git.ipfire.org Git - thirdparty/bugzilla.git/commitdiff
Bug 557324: object_before_delete does not work when object is Bugzilla::Classification
authorTiago Mello <timello@linux.vnet.ibm.com>
Wed, 7 Apr 2010 18:01:49 +0000 (20:01 +0200)
committerFrédéric Buclin <LpSolit@gmail.com>
Wed, 7 Apr 2010 18:01:49 +0000 (20:01 +0200)
r/a=mkanat

Bugzilla/Classification.pm

index a7f59b4bbab5314b8a874274c19df018c9e756c3..322b5cf990b0b705b3a5ce4ea708c6493bff2215 100644 (file)
@@ -70,7 +70,7 @@ sub remove_from_db {
     $dbh->do("UPDATE products SET classification_id = 1
               WHERE classification_id = ?", undef, $self->id);
 
-    $dbh->do("DELETE FROM classifications WHERE id = ?", undef, $self->id);
+    $self->SUPER::remove_from_db();
 
     $dbh->bz_commit_transaction();